Riley Voelkel
Riley Emilia Voelkel is a American-born Canadian actress. She is known for portraying Freya Mikaelson on The CW television series The Originals and Legacies. Voelkel also played the role of Jenna Johnson on the HBO television series The Newsroom. In 2013, she played the younger version of Jessica Lange's character, the witch Fiona Goode in the FX series American Horror Story: Coven.
Sue Johnston
Susan Johnston, OBE is an English actress known for playing Sheila Grant in the Channel 4 soap opera Brookside (1982–1990), Barbara Royle in the BBC comedy The Royle Family, Grace Foley in the BBC drama Waking the Dead (2000–2011), Gloria Price in the ITV soap opera Coronation Street (2012–2014) and Miss Denker in the ITV drama Downton Abbey (2014–2015). She won the 2000 British Comedy Award for Best TV Comedy Actress and was nominated for the 2000 BAFTA TV Award for Best Comedy Performance for The Royle Family.
Annie Ilonzeh
Annette Ngozi Ilonzeh is an American actress. From 2010 to 2011, she played Maya Ward on the ABC daytime soap opera General Hospital, and later starred as Kate Prince in the short-lived ABC reboot of Charlie's Angels. She later had a recurring roles on shows such as Arrow, Drop Dead Diva and Empire. In 2017, Ilonzeh played Kidada Jones in the biographical drama film All Eyez on Me, and starred in the thriller 'Til Death Do Us Part. In 2018, she started co-starring as Emily Foster in the NBC drama Chicago Fire.

Simbi Khali
Simbi Khali, sometimes credited as Simbi Kali Williams, is an American actress and singer best known for her role as Nina Campbell on the NBC sitcom 3rd Rock from the Sun.

Madeleine Mantock
Madeleine Mantock is a British actress. She is known for her main role television work on the series Into the Badlands and a remake of the series The Tomorrow People. Since 2018, she has appeared in the lead role of witch Macy Vaughn on The CW series Charmed. She appeared in the The Long Song as Miss Clara in a supporting role.
Virginia McKenna
Virginia Anne McKenna, OBE, is an English stage and screen actress, author and wildlife campaigner. She is best known for the films A Town Like Alice (1956), Carve Her Name with Pride (1958), Born Free (1966), and Ring of Bright Water (1969), as well as her work with The Born Free Foundation.
